Skouras Pictures, was an American independent movie distribution company that was founded by Tom Skouras in 1983.[1] The company distributed more than 200 movies between 1983 and 1995, including notable films as Blood Simple, My Life as a Dog, The Comfort of Strangers and Apartment Zero.[1][2]
